What is an economy of scale?
Economies of scale occur when increasing output leads to lower long-run average costs.
What processes or advancements make mass production more accessible?
Technological advancements
Jigs
Standardised components
Stock forms
Moulds
Templates
What is a jig?
A jig is used in manufacturing to hold a workpiece in a fixed position while ensuring that the cutting tool moves along a precise path.
What is a mould?
A structure used to shape materials.
What is a fixture?
A fixture is used to securely hold, support or position a workpiece during machining or assembly operations.
One-off production:
Few workers
Highly skilled workers
Materials can be carefully and uniquely selected for each product
Usually done in a small workshop
Client focused
Expensive
Time intensive
